- dramatize⇄dramatize, verb, -tized,-tizing.
- dramatize⇄v.i. 1. to behave dramatically; act in an exaggerated or emotional manner.
Ex. Stop dramatizing and describe exactly what happened.
2. to adapt to dramatization.
Ex. The story would dramatize admirably (New Monthly Magazine).
3. - dramatize⇄v.t. 1. to arrange or present in the form of a play; make a drama of.
Ex. The children dramatized the story of Rip Van Winkle.
2. to make seem exciting and thrilling; show or express in a dramatic way.
